Finite element method is used more and more in warship structure assessment. But there is no unitive platform covering structure design and analysis to actualize automatic modeling in analysis software, which makes the fast assessment of ship structure capability can not be performed and furthermore, the cycle of the new ship type would be longer. So, it makes particle sense in creating a unitive platform covering structure design and analysis to make fast assessment of ship structure capability.The interface between 3D design software and CAE software is designed to make CAE model generated automatically from 3D design software. Based on the CAE software, a program including functions of load transfer, automatic loading, inertial force balance and result post-process is further developed, and then a unitive 3D platform covering structure design and analysis is built finally. Taking a warship as example, the whole process of model creating, model transfer, automatic loading, inertia balance and result post-process is completed based on this platform. Finally,the FE analysis is done by Sesam to supply procession and results reference to the followed job.
